Blue light, defined as short-wavelength visible light ranging from 400 to 500 nm, is recognized for its high energy within the visible light spectrum. The prevalent use of light-emitting diodes (LEDs) has significantly increased exposure to blue light. Corneal endothelial cells (CECs) playing a crucial role in maintaining corneal transparency to get clear visual field.

The neurological manifestations of SHORT syndrome include intrauterine growth restriction, microcephaly, intellectual disability, hearing loss, and speech delay. SHORT syndrome is generally believed to be caused by PIK3R1 gene mutations and impaired PI3K-AKT activation. Recently, a clinical case report described a SHORT syndrome with a novel mutant in PRKCE gene encoding protein kinase Cε (PKCε).
